Hello there!   It's Cassie back with another card, and this time I would to try stretching one of my non-Holiday stamp sets and use it for a Holiday card.  I decided to pair up the Llama Friends stamp and the Gingerbread Village stamp.  I stamped three llamas with Raven Detail Ink on a panel of watercolor paper.  I used some watercolor pencils to color the llamas and then gave them a quick brush with a glitter marker.

I cut some Sweater Weather Paper down to cover the front of an A2 card.  For my sentiment I stamped the 'G-llama-rous' sentiment onto that same watercolor paper.  I then lined up the 'Winter Wishes' sentiment from the Gingerbread Village set and masked off the word 'Winter' so that I would only stamp the 'Wishes' sentiment under the word 'G-llama-rous'.  And voila, a non-holiday set was used on a holiday card!
